I couldn't agree with you more...both about it being great, & about it being a shame that he chose to cut SO much of the show...
Here's the full set list & what was cut...via a post of mine from another thread on this album on this forum...
It's certainly Paul's artistic right to do whatever he wants...I just hope he wasn't led in this (mis)direction by the record company...I was at the show & honestly can't figure out why the songs that were left off, were left off (except for the songs that featured David Byrne)
"So GREAT to have any documentation of this tour & band, but... WHY OH WHY WITH ALL THE SPACE ON CD'S (& DVD's) DID HE CUT SO MANY GREAT SONGS!?!?! I was there at this show & understand David Byrne screwed up "You Can Call Me Al", & I get not including "Road To Nowhere", but...it's especially criminal to have cut both "Questions For The Angels" & "Peace Like A River"!!!- two brilliant performances of two great deep album tracks that haven't been beaten to death live!!!! And his cover of "Here Comes The Sun" was just completely sublime!! Not to mention both "Mystery Train" & "Wheels", as well as "Vietnam", were all great too & really good fun & unique parts to making this tour something more than just all the big songs everyone expects...a missed opportunity of truly major proportions!!!! I don't understand it at all!!! And I wonder if the order listed is wrong...everything else in the right order, but they've switched out "The Boy In The Bubble" & "The Obvious Child"...
Full Webster Hall Set List:
**= Song that was cut...
The Boy in the Bubble
Dazzling Blue
50 Ways To Leave Your Lover
So Beautiful or So What
**Vietnam**
Mother And Child Reunion
That Was Your Mother
Hearts And Bones
**Mystery Train**
**Wheels**
Slip Slidin' Away
Rewrite
**Peace Like a River**
The Obvious Child
The Only Living Boy In New York
The Afterlife
**Questions for the Angels**
Diamonds On The Soles Of Her Shoes
Gumboots
Encore:
The Sound of Silence
Kodachrome
Gone At Last
**Here Comes the Sun**
Late In The Evening
Encore 2:
**Road to Nowhere (with David Byrne**
**You Can Call Me Al(with David Byrne)**
Still Crazy After All These Years
Crazy Love, Vol. II"
